Transaction 34ff4030661235a420f64408ac61868e2346372be6730bf76cfeb17bc1168eae

1 Input
2 Outputs
  • 34ff4030661235a420f64408ac61868e2346372be6730bf76cfeb17bc1168eae:0
  • value  225114
    address  bc1qkqsu644rmmvhyr5z6kck2dcs8ej6ezw2fre4eg
  • 34ff4030661235a420f64408ac61868e2346372be6730bf76cfeb17bc1168eae:1
  • value  30310739
    address  bc1qmjjsw67kkrnewj8pzujsvt82r40nmp2vrfqgwcc77pgclr9yk4wssqj4kv